Me'Zelf is my personally designed Original Character, under my ownership. He represents my imagination and persona.
An insight to Me'Zelf's simple yet extremely complex ability at the same time. It depicts how I was thinking about the applications, which was the complex part that made the ability so versatile and powerful. There were some lighting issues during the phototaking process, because the paper was worked to it's limits. It somehow gave my character's shadow a lighting effect, combined with the shading textures set in them. The ability appear like black flames with a purple tinge (similar to Nanatsu no Taizai, I shared a similar concept of appearance from the start).
The rainbow colored lines are actually another one of my important mental images, same with my character and his ability. They depict my understanding of creativity. This is the first piece of work incorporating them. More appearances will follow.
Ability: Shadow Bending
Attributes: Shadow, Void, Reality Bending
Effects: Propulsion, Tangibility Shift, Shapeshifting
Weakness: Light, Unable to interact directly with physical entities
Introduction:
Me'Zelf is originally an ethereal being, so he doesn't wield breath abilities. Instead he conjures his shadow, which is an extension of himself. The effects are straightfoward, but the complexity comes with the flexibility of application. He can use it to generate propulsion, strenghten his physique, remove physical tangibility, and shapeshift.
He prefers to avoid using it for offensive purposes, usually for slipping away from trouble. Practicality is favoured over flashy moves, and usage is avoided in public if possible. He is well aware of its powerful potential, and really tries to hide it (he wants to be as normal as possible). The ability makes him too menacing to the public, gaining too much attention for his comfort. He prefers his current form rather than the intangible monster form in the mindscape (or how he described it).
Applications:
- Shadow Propulsion generates propulsion, and cannot do the opposite. It offers the speed attribute to my character in action, also the most common form of application.
- Increasing tangibility (Physical Augmentation) increases strength or toughness, often active when exerting force. It makes him a harder hitter for his light build, but he usually doesn't use that concept for defense. Reinforcing the body also makes certain postures possible for his body build.
- Decreasing tangibility (Ethereal Shift) by transforming into the shadow avoids physical contact, great for avoiding physical harm. This is also the most flexible application, allowing shapeshifting, regeneration. In the shapeshifting aspect, there's a snag that keeps my character's color profile regardless of what form taken.
These limit him to mostly physical attributes, plenty of speed and strength. The applications can be used in combos or in quick succession, depending on the condition of his casted shadow. When the shadow is conjured, it's casted form vanishes. The ability strenghtens if the shadow or its contrast gets deeper. There is no physical limitation to wield, only mental focus. Light can burn it away, but please consider how real shadows work, it's not so simple as a hard counter.
